Rebar prices in Turkey regress to psychological barrier

Wednesday, 14 March 2012 17:36:31 (GMT+3)   |  
       

The Turkish domestic rebar market is still characterized by uncertainty and silence.
 
As of today, traders' 12 mm rebar prices in the Turkish market have declined to TRY 1,185-1,212/mt ($658-673/mt) + VAT  ex-warehouse. Thus, prices have regressed to the psychological barrier of TRY 1,185/mt, back to the levels recorded on February 22 when the previous upward trend had started. 



 
SteelOrbis has learned from market sources that activity in the Turkish rebar market is fairly limited and that transactions are restricted to small tonnages. Buyers are currently abstaining from concluding new purchases due to the uncertain market conditions.
 
$1 = TRY 1.80
